Supplemental figures for "Integrating Machine Learning and Remote Sensing to Determine Crop Nitrogen Content of Maize"

Susanta Das · Shiva Bhambota · Uday Bhanu Prakash Vaddevolu · Bibek Acharya · Charles Colvin · Jay M Capasso · Rajveer Dhillon · Vivek Sharma

American Society of Agricultural and Biological Engineers (ASABE) · 9 Jun 2026 · 10.13031/31968177

Abstract

This study developed machine learning models to predict maize crop nitrogen content (CNC) using vegetation indices derived from UAV and satellite imagery. Several models were evaluated, with Random Forest demonstrating the best performance. The study emphasizes that combining vegetation indices enhances prediction accuracy more than using individual spectral bands. Results show reliable CNC estimation across growth stages, although predictions at early stages are less precise due to low canopy cover and soil interference. The approach allows for real-time, field-to-regional-scale nitrogen monitoring, supporting improved fertilizer management and precision agriculture decision-making.
